What is NeuBird AI?
NeuBird AI is an autonomous production operations agent built by NeuBird, Inc., a Delaware company based in Redwood City, California. It plugs into an existing observability and cloud stack, watches every signal continuously, and takes on work an on-call team would otherwise do by hand: spotting anomalies, correlating alerts, isolating root cause and driving remediation.
The vendor organises the product around three moments. Prevent correlates every deployment, flag flip and configuration change with the risk it introduces, and opens an investigation as soon as behaviour drifts. Resolve traces causal chains across logs, metrics, traces and deploys, then returns root cause, blast radius and a remediation plan; the site claims up to 92% MTTR reduction and 94% root cause accuracy. Operate covers the quiet periods, hunting idle capacity and misconfiguration to trim cloud spend, with more than 200 engineering hours recovered per month claimed.
Six preset skills ship with the product — Change Intelligence, Incident Investigator, Root Cause Analysis, Runbook Automation, Alert Triage and Cost Optimizer — and five specialised agents run behind them: a Triage Agent that monitors permanently, an Investigation Agent, an Analyst Agent, a Cluster Agent for groups of related alerts, and a Discovery Agent for conversational queries over telemetry.
Security is the main argument. A proprietary data layer called GenDB separates reasoning from execution: sensitive identifiers such as IP addresses and personal data are stripped before anything reaches a language model, the model returns a strategy, and GenDB runs the queries locally. The documentation states that customer data is never used to train models and that connections are read-only. Three deployment models are documented, including a Private VPC install that runs entirely inside the customer's own AWS account.
Twenty-nine named connections cover observability, cloud, databases, DevOps, ITSM and chat, among them Datadog, AWS, Azure, Google Cloud, Grafana, Prometheus, Splunk, ServiceNow, Jira, Slack and Snowflake. Three interfaces are offered: a web platform, a locally installed command-line tool, and an MCP server that exposes investigations to assistants such as Claude, Cursor or GitHub Copilot. NeuBird is SOC 2 Type II certified.
What it does
- Detect anomalies across logs, metrics, traces and events before an alert fires
- Group, deduplicate and rank noisy alerts, cutting volume by up to 90%
- Isolate root cause by tracing causal chains across services and recent deployments
- Assess blast radius and identify which customers an incident affects
- Execute remediation runbooks, roll back a faulty deployment or scale a resource with a full audit trail
- Correlate every deploy, feature flag and config change with the risk it introduces
- Hunt idle capacity and misconfiguration between incidents to reduce cloud spend

Pricing & Plans
There is no permanent free plan and no published price. The pricing page displays a single Enterprise plan on custom pricing, reached through a sales contact. Consumption is measured in credits bought as needed: the Triage Agent runs continuously without consuming any, an Investigation or Analyst Agent costs one credit per run, a Cluster Agent two, and the Discovery Agent one credit per ten runs. The vendor's own sizing guidance is roughly 100 credits a month for 1,000 alerts and 1,000 credits for 10,000 alerts, with volumes around 50,000 alerts moving to bespoke enterprise terms. Alerts themselves are always unlimited, and the vendor states there are no ingest, storage or surprise fees. A 14-day trial with 50 credits is available without a credit card.

Data, GDPR & hosting
A consolidated view of how NeuBird AI handles your data.
GDPR overview
The GDPR framework is real but it lives entirely in the Data Processing Addendum, not in the privacy policy. The addendum defines European Data Protection Law as the EU and UK GDPR, commits both parties to comply with their obligations under it, and incorporates the Module 2 Standard Contractual Clauses together with the ICO's UK Addendum for restricted transfers. It covers processor duties: processing on documented instructions, subprocessor notification with a seven-day objection window, breach notification without undue delay, assistance with impact assessments, annual audits on request to security@neubird.ai, and deletion of customer personal data within 90 days of termination. The privacy policy itself never mentions the GDPR and addresses only United States law. No Article 27 EU representative and no data protection officer is named.
Who owns the data?
Under the Master Subscription Agreement and the Data Processing Addendum, the customer remains the controller of its own data and NeuBird acts as a processor, working only on the customer's written instructions. NeuBird keeps two carve-outs. Article 4.3 of the subscription agreement grants it the right to collect, retain and analyse anonymised metadata from the customer's use of the product to improve its services, during and after the contract term. Article 11 of the addendum lets it create anonymised or aggregated Analytics Data and use, publicise or share that data with third parties. Feedback sent to NeuBird can be exploited freely without compensation. The security pages state that customer intellectual property stays with the customer.
Reuse rights
The agreement is written for a business customer, not for an end user reselling output. Customers keep their own telemetry and remain responsible for how they use the root cause analyses, remediation plans and audit records the agent produces; nothing in the collected documents makes those outputs the vendor's property or requires permission to reuse them internally. What the customer cannot control is the anonymised layer: metadata derived from product usage, and aggregated Analytics Data that NeuBird may publish or share with third parties, are both carved out by contract. Data subject requests are handled by the customer, with NeuBird redirecting any request it receives and providing reasonable assistance.

Hosting summary
No hosting country or region is stated anywhere on the site or in the documentation. AWS is the only named substrate, and three deployment models are described. In the standard SaaS model the application runs in NeuBird's own account while the customer's telemetry stays in the customer's environment and is queried remotely. In the bring-your-own-LLM model the application still runs in NeuBird's account but the customer supplies its own AWS Bedrock and DocumentDB instances. In the Private VPC model the entire stack is deployed inside the customer's AWS account through CloudFormation and, according to the vendor, no data crosses the account boundary. With a VPC or VNET deployment, only the metadata needed for agent coordination leaves the customer's perimeter. Encryption is applied at rest and in transit, with TLS 1.3 cited for transport, and test and development environments are kept separate from production. Buyers with a data residency requirement will have to obtain that commitment contractually, since it is not documented publicly.
Things to keep in mind
Risks and trade-offs to weigh before adopting NeuBird AI.
- No published price at all: budgeting is impossible without a sales conversation, and comparison with alternatives is equally blind
- Zero data retention is claimed on the platform and documentation pages while the Enterprise plan advertises unlimited historical storage and the trial 14 days of it: ask which one governs your contract
- The documentation calls modification of your systems technically impossible, yet product pages describe runbook execution, deployment rollbacks and connection pool scaling: confirm what the agent is actually allowed to touch
- Handing incident response to an agent can erode a team's own diagnostic instincts; the engineers who never work an incident manually are the ones who will struggle when the agent is wrong
- Anonymised metadata is collected and analysed during and after the contract term, and aggregated Analytics Data may be published or shared with third parties
- Contracts renew automatically by default, with a 14-day opt-out window after the initial order form and 30 days' notice required for non-renewal; your company name may also be used in marketing material unless you opt out in writing
- The subprocessor list is not published and no hosting country is stated, which will slow down any procurement review that requires either
Setup & Integrations
Technical difficulty
Moderate, and clearly aimed at engineers. The vendor promises integration in minutes with no code changes, and its customer testimonial supports a fast start, but the work is real on the customer side: IAM roles with external IDs and custom trust policies on AWS, registered applications on Azure, scoped service accounts on GCP, and rotated API keys for third-party tools. A Private VPC deployment adds a CloudFormation install in your own account, and the bring-your-own-LLM model requires supplying Bedrock and DocumentDB. The prerequisite is having an observability stack and the cloud permissions to connect it.

Should you pick NeuBird AI?
NeuBird AI is a serious enterprise product, not a landing page with a promise attached. The company is identifiable, four legal documents are published, the technical documentation lives on its own site, twenty-nine connections are named one by one, and a customer is quoted by name. The proposition is narrow and legible: give an autonomous agent read access to the observability stack you already own, and let it absorb the triage and remediation work that keeps engineers awake.
What sets it apart is the architecture rather than the marketing. Sensitive identifiers are stripped before anything reaches a language model, execution happens locally through the GenDB layer, credentials are short-lived, and an entire deployment model runs inside the customer's own AWS account. Customer data is explicitly never used for training. For a security-conscious buyer, that is the part worth reading twice.
Three reservations deserve attention before signing. First, pricing is entirely opaque: no amount is published in any currency, the credit system is described but never costed, and a plan mentioned in the FAQ does not appear on the page. Second, two internal contradictions remain unresolved — zero data retention claimed alongside unlimited historical storage, and architecturally enforced read-only access alongside pages describing rollbacks and resource scaling. Third, the GDPR framework sits in the addendum while the privacy policy addresses United States law only, and the subprocessor schedule is referenced but never published.
The headline figures — 92% MTTR reduction, 94% root cause accuracy, 73% of issues prevented — come from the vendor without published methodology and should be read as claims. NeuBird is young: the site first appeared in April 2024 and roughly USD 63.8 million has been raised since. A well-argued product for teams that already own the stack to plug it into, provided the pricing conversation happens early.
